FocusObserver (engine/view/observer)
@ckeditor/ckeditor5-engine/src/view/observer/focusobserver
Focus and blur events observer. Focus observer handle also isFocused property of the root elements.
Note that this observer is attached by the View
and is available by default.

disable()
inherited
Disables the observer. This method is called before rendering to prevent firing events during rendering.
-
enable()
inherited
Enables the observer. This method is called when the observer is registered to the
View
and after rendering (all observers are disabled before rendering).A typical use case for disabling observers is that mutation observers need to be disabled for the rendering. However, a child class may not need to be disabled, so it can implement an empty method.
